Gobindapur

Gobindapur is a village located in Purbasthali Ii subdivision of Barddhaman district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 18.5km away from sub-district headquarter Purbasthali . Barddhaman is the district headquarter of Gobindapur village. As per 2009 stats, Muksimpara is the gram panchayat of Gobindapur village.

About Gobindap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gobindapur is 319610. The village spans a total geographical area of 100.51 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 713513. Nabadwip is nearest town to Gobindap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Gobindapur

According to the 2011 Census, Gobindapur has a total population of about 639, with approximately 295 males and 344 females. The sex ratio is around 1166 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 68 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 124 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 41. The overall literacy rate is approximately 44.76%, with male literacy at about 50.17% and female literacy near 40.12%. There are around 154 households in the village. Connectivity of Gobindap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gobindapur. As per the 2011 stats, Gobindap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
